Vermont hospitals stuck caring for patients who can’t get into nursing homes, costing millions
Vermont Public · November 29, 2022
Hospital administrators in Vermont and across the country say having to care for long term patients who should be in nursing homes is causing bottlenecks in their emergency rooms and millions of dollars in financial losses.
